Datadog is hiring a People Analyst II to leverage data for informed people decisions. You'll collaborate with leadership to deliver insights and analyses using SQL and BI tools. This role requires 2-5 years of experience in people analytics or a related field.
Job Description
Who you are
You have 2–5+ years of experience in people analytics, business analytics, or a related quantitative role — your strong analytical skills enable you to derive insights from complex datasets and inform strategic decisions. Proficiency in SQL and Google Sheets is essential, and you have experience working with BI tools such as Tableau, Metabase, or Looker, which allows you to create impactful visualizations and dashboards. You understand the importance of data quality, privacy, and governance when handling sensitive employee information, ensuring that your analyses are both accurate and compliant.
You thrive in collaborative environments, partnering with People Business Partners, Recruiting, and senior leadership to translate ambiguous business questions into structured analyses. Your ability to proactively identify and predict trends, patterns, and drivers of people outcomes such as attrition and performance is a key asset. You are detail-oriented and committed to maintaining high standards in your work, which contributes to the overall success of the People Analytics Team at Datadog.
Desirable
Experience with advanced analytics techniques or statistical methods would be a plus, as would familiarity with HR systems and processes. You are comfortable conducting research studies and analyses to support programmatic decision-making and key initiatives across the employee lifecycle. Your curiosity drives you to explore new methodologies and tools that can enhance the effectiveness of people analytics at Datadog.
What you'll do
As a People Analyst II at Datadog, you will play a crucial role in shaping how the organization hires, develops, retains, and supports its employees. You will proactively identify and predict trends that impact people outcomes, such as attrition and career growth, providing valuable insights to leadership. Your work will involve conducting custom analyses that address priority workforce questions, translating complex business needs into actionable insights.
You will build and maintain dashboards, reports, and recurring metrics readouts that track key performance indicators related to hiring, performance, retention, and employee sentiment. Your ability to communicate findings clearly and effectively will help drive data-informed decision-making across the organization. You will collaborate closely with various teams, ensuring that your analyses align with the strategic goals of the business.
